Key Features
Part of the Textologie series, specifically volume 7, providing a structured academic context for study.
Addresses the historical debate regarding the linguistic turn and its impact on Husserl's philosophical standing.
Examines the specific critiques made by post-structural literary theory concerning phenomenology.
Offers a detailed investigation into the poetological and logical implications of Husserl's work.
Provides a scholarly counter-argument to the idea that phenomenology neglects the role of language.
